Best No-Pull Harness for Labrador Retrievers

Quick Answer: Labradors need a front-clip no-pull harness with wide chest padding, metal D-rings, and a top control handle. Labs are enthusiastic, powerful, and food-motivated — the front clip redirects their pulling and the control handle manages sudden lunges. Most Labs fit Large or XL.

Why Labs Pull So Hard

Labradors were bred as working retrievers — they run, they fetch, they cover ground. Their enthusiasm for everything makes them committed pullers on leash. A back-clip harness gives a Lab a sled dog setup. A front-clip harness redirects that energy into enjoyable walks within a few weeks.
